Transaction 7588a752485aa70851b54c0872912f35048744f392e680827e7e82d9ae9531d4
1 Input
1 Output
-
7588a752485aa70851b54c0872912f35048744f392e680827e7e82d9ae9531d4:0
- value
- 1978070
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a9dd1541e5a8a96b4a55ef3fe1d6a3baf93fce89 OP_EQUAL
- address
- 3HBAy5hPLuvWHCG69JFznn8dAY4YdnjEvc